Troubleshooting Common Issues with Your A11VO Pump

Experiencing problems with your A11VO axial pump? Please don't worry! Many common issues are fairly resolved with a little basic troubleshooting. First, verify the oil level; inadequate levels can cause reduced performance. Next, look at the filter ; a obstructed filter restricts flow. In addition, listen for any strange noises, which could indicate internal damage. If the pump fails , think about checking the powering connection and ensure proper power is being delivered . Here's a quick summary :

  • Check Fluid Level
  • Examine the Filter
  • Note for Rumbles
  • Assess the Drive Connection

Note that major breakdowns demand professional servicing ; don't hesitate to reach out to a experienced technician if required .

A11VO Pump Maintenance: Extending Lifespan and Efficiency

Proper care of your A11VO power pump is critical for maximizing its longevity and sustained efficiency. Scheduled maintenance practices can substantially reduce the potential of costly repairs and unexpected downtime. This includes routine checks of oil levels and cleanliness, along with replacing filters at the recommended intervals. Resolving any minor issues promptly can avoid more extensive damage.

  • Observe fluid levels regularly .
  • Substitute filters as indicated in the supplier's instructions .
  • Clean the power system occasionally .
  • Evaluate for leaks and repair them immediately.
  • Maintain correct operating temperatures .

Neglecting this basic practices can lead to accelerated deterioration and a lower overall output of the A11VO pump . Ultimately, reliable maintenance translates to a more productive and economical operation.

Choosing the Right A11VO Power Pump for Your Setup

Determining the most suitable A11VO hydraulic assembly for your unique system involves thorough assessment of several important aspects. Consider the needed volume, working pressure, and preferred output. Furthermore, matching the unit's capacity with your machine's demands is essential for reliable operation and to eliminate possible damage. Ultimately, check compatibility with your existing hydraulic system and adhere manufacturer's recommendations for maximum performance.
